pub struct BuildPool { /* private fields */ }Implementations§
Source§impl BuildPool
impl BuildPool
Sourcepub fn metadata_task(&self, repo: &EbuildRepo) -> MetadataTaskBuilder
pub fn metadata_task(&self, repo: &EbuildRepo) -> MetadataTaskBuilder
Create an ebuild package metadata regeneration task builder.
Sourcepub fn pretend<T: Into<Cpv>>(
&self,
repo: &EbuildRepo,
cpv: T,
) -> Result<Option<String>>
pub fn pretend<T: Into<Cpv>>( &self, repo: &EbuildRepo, cpv: T, ) -> Result<Option<String>>
Run the pkg_pretend phase for an ebuild package.
Trait Implementations§
impl Sync for BuildPool
Auto Trait Implementations§
impl !Freeze for BuildPool
impl !RefUnwindSafe for BuildPool
impl Send for BuildPool
impl Unpin for BuildPool
impl UnwindSafe for BuildPool
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> Instrument for T
impl<T> Instrument for T
Source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
Source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
Source§impl<T> IntoEither for T
impl<T> IntoEither for T
Source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reSource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read more